Program Overview:
River Edge is currently seeking a Full-time Group Leader for the Judiciary In-reach Program. Under the supervision of the Program Manager, the Group Leader will meet with detainees in a group setting in the jail to conduct group session for both male and female detainees in the areas of mental health and substance use disorder. River Edge professionals shall help identify non-violent misdemeanor offenders who need mental health services, and work with Bibb County Sheriff's Office (BCSO) to refer them to appropriate care.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ist detainees in articulating personal goals for recovery through the use group sessions. During these sessions the Group Leader will support detainees in identifying and creating goals and developing recovery plans with the skills, strengths, support and resources to aid them in achieving those goals.
- Assist detainees in working with their case manager in determining the steps he/she needs to take to achieve these goals and self-directed recovery.
- Generating recovery reviews and performance documents to track the rehabilitation process.
- Observing behavior and evidence of general well-being and discussing observations with the clients.
- Report any unusual behavior, conflicts, or recovery deviations to the relevant professionals.
Qualifications:
- Certified Peer Specialist Certification (Required).
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university with a major in social services related disciplines (Social work, sociology, psychology). (preferred).
- WHAM Certified, Forensic Peer Specialist (preferred).
- Previous experience working in a behavioral health care setting is preferred.
